Whether you’re endlessly scrolling through Netflix, struggling to decide on a restaurant, or feeling overwhelmed by endless options for where to live, who to date, or where to work, chances are you’ve experienced “Infinite Browsing Mode.” But is the temptation to always keep our options open actually hurting us? In this episode, author and civic advocate Pete Davis shares why it’s much more productive – and satisfying – to just commit already.  Show Notes: Join our Discord Server!  Guest: Pete Davis, author of “Dedicated: The Case for Commitment in an Age of Infinite Browsing” Connect With Pete Davis: Website, Twitter, Instagram, Substack 2018 Harvard Commencement Address“Join or Die” documentary  “Bowling Alone: The Collapse and Revival of American Community” by Robert Putnam “I and Thou” by Martin Buber Fr.
